<h1>The Supreme Court of India dismissed the Special Leave Petition after condoning the delay.</h1> The Supreme Court of India dismissed the Special Leave Petition after condoning the delay. - TMI Revision u/s 263 - Whether depreciation at the enhanced rate of 30% for a vehicle can be claimed by an assessee who does not run a business of hiring out the vehicle for consideration? - distinction ought to be made between the two parts to Section 263 - HELD THAT:- SLP dismissed. The Supreme Court of India dismissed the Special Leave Petition after condoning the delay. (2019 (3) TMI 1173 - SC)
